Jon Vesterholm is a young Danish pipemaker and he lives in a small town in the country side surrounded by the beautiful landscape. He currently works as a teacher at a production school in the carpentry workshop. He started making pipes professionally at 2011. It was in his opinion quite good. He had to use his wood lathe, drill press, too many hours and lots of patience. He has made many more since then and is very conscious of technique, detail, form, color, and vein drawings. Now, his production is around 100 pipes per year. He makes both Freehand and classic shapes.
"I've learned from some of the best Danish contemporary pipe makers, Jess Chonowitsch and former, which I visit regularly to get some feedback on the things I do, and I always come home with new techniques that to try. I like the expression and artistic ways the freehand takes me but also the classic sharp cuts who demands the proportion to be very precise" he said.
